Поделиться через


Тип ресурса userConsentRequest

Пространство имен: microsoft.graph

Представляет сведения о запросе согласия, создаваемом пользователем при запросе на доступ к приложению или предоставлении разрешений приложению. Сведения включают обоснование запроса доступа, состояние запроса и сведения об утверждении.

Пользователь может создать запрос на согласие, если приложению или разрешению требуется авторизация администратора, и только если рабочий процесс согласия администратора включен.

Методы

Метод Тип возвращаемых данных Описание
Список Коллекция userConsentRequest Получение коллекции объектов userConsentRequest для appConsentRequest.
Получение userConsentRequest Чтение свойств и связей объекта userConsentRequest .
Фильтрация по текущему пользователю Коллекция userConsentRequest Чтение свойств объектов userConsentRequest для appConsentRequest , для которого текущий пользователь является рецензентом.

Свойства

Свойство Тип Описание
approvalId String Идентификатор утверждения. Это значение равно значению id.
completedDateTime DateTimeOffset Дата и время, когда состояние запроса было отмечено как Completed. Сведения о времени и дате представлены в формате ISO 8601 (всегда используется формат UTC). Например, значение полуночи 1 января 2014 г. в формате UTC: 2014-01-01T00:00:00Z.
createdBy identitySet Пользователь, создавший запрос.
createdDateTime DateTimeOffset Дата и время создания запроса. Сведения о времени и дате представлены в формате ISO 8601 (всегда используется формат UTC). Например, значение полуночи 1 января 2014 г. в формате UTC: 2014-01-01T00:00:00Z. Поддерживает $filter (eq только) и $orderby.
customData String Свободное текстовое поле для определения любых пользовательских данных для запроса на согласие пользователя. Не используется.
id String Идентификатор запроса.
reason String Обоснование пользователя для запроса доступа к приложению. Поддерживает $filter (eq только) и $orderby.
status String Состояние запроса на согласие приложения пользователя. Возможные значения: Initializing, InProgress, Expired и Completed. Поддерживает $filter (eq только) и $orderby.

Связи

Связь Тип Описание
утверждение утверждение Решения об утверждении, связанные с запросом.

Представление JSON

В следующем представлении JSON показан тип ресурса.

{
  "@odata.type": "#microsoft.graph.userConsentRequest",
  "id": "String (identifier)",
  "status": "String",
  "completedDateTime": "String (timestamp)",
  "createdDateTime": "String (timestamp)",
  "approvalId": "String",
  "customData": "String",
  "createdBy": {
    "@odata.type": "microsoft.graph.identitySet"
  },
  "reason": "String"
}